With the ever-evolving job market, it's crucial for parents and educators to stay informed about the most in-demand skills and roles. In this section, we'll explore the top five careers to consider for your child's future, based on job market trends and salary ranges. 1. **Data Scientist (Average salary: £120,000)** Data Scientists are in high demand across various industries, as they can extract valuable insights from vast datasets. This role involves statistical analysis, machine learning, and data visualization, making it an ideal fit for students with strong math and programming skills. 2. **Software Developer (Average salary: £100,000)** Software Developers design, code, and test software applications for various platforms. This role is essential in today's digital world, as software is an integral part of our daily lives. Aspiring Software Developers should focus on learning popular programming languages like Python, JavaScript, and C#. 3. **Cybersecurity Specialist (Average salary: £80,000)** With the increasing reliance on technology, Cybersecurity Specialists play a critical role in protecting sensitive information and digital assets. This role involves identifying vulnerabilities, implementing security measures, and responding to cyber threats. 4. **AI Engineer (Average salary: £150,000)** AI Engineers are responsible for designing and implementing artificial intelligence systems, such as machine learning algorithms and natural language processing tools. This role typically requires strong programming skills and a solid understanding of machine learning principles. 5. **Cloud Architect (Average salary: £90,000)** Cloud Architects design, build, and maintain cloud infrastructure for organizations. With the rise of cloud computing, this role is becoming increasingly important for businesses looking to reduce costs and improve scalability.
